2 John 1:5-13

Listen to 2 John 1:5-13
5 Now I ask you, lady, 1not as though I were writing to you a new commandment, but the one which we have had 2from the beginning, that we 3love one another.
6 And 4this is love, that we walk according to His commandments. This is the commandment, 5just as you have heard 6from the beginning, that you should walk in it.
7 For 7many deceivers have 8gone out into the world, those who 9do not acknowledge Jesus Christ as coming in the flesh. This is 10the deceiver and the 11antichrist.
8 12Watch yourselves, 13that you do not lose what we have accomplished, but that you may receive a full reward.
9 [a]Anyone who [b]goes too far and 14does not abide in the teaching of Christ, does not have God; the one who abides in the teaching, he has both the Father and the Son.
10 If anyone comes to you and does not bring this teaching, 15do not receive him into your house, and do not give him a greeting;
11 for the one who gives him a greeting 16participates in his evil deeds.
12 17Though I have many things to write to you, I do not want to do so with paper and ink; but I hope to come to you and speak face to face, so that [c]your 18joy may be made full.
13 The children of your 19chosen sister greet you.
